This sentence in the header file comment (which should be in the documentation 
but isn't) explains the problem.

> The bookmark data must have been created with the 
> kCFURLBookmarkCreationSuitableForBookmarkFile option.

The bookmark data created by CFURLCreateBookmarkDataFromAliasRecord() won't 
have the kCFURLBookmarkCreationSuitableForBookmarkFile option set in it.

Before CFURLCreateBookmarkDataFromAliasRecord(), Finder Alias files (bookmark 
files) were created by the Finder and so we needed the bookmark data in the 
files created by CFURLCreateBookmarkDataFromAliasRecord() to provide the same 
(and a little more) functionality. The 
kCFURLBookmarkCreationSuitableForBookmarkFile option enforces that.

So, if you want to create a bookmark file from an AliasRecord, you either have 
to:

(1) Resolve the AliasHandle to a FSRef, convert the FSRef to a CFURL, create a 
bookmark to the CFURL using the kCFURLBookmarkCreationSuitableForBookmarkFile 
option, and then write the bookmark.

(2) Do what your stack overflow code does but after creating the bookmark from 
the AliasRecord, resolve the bookmark to its target, and then create a new 
bookmark to the target using the kCFURLBookmarkCreationSuitableForBookmarkFile 
option, and then write the bookmark.

CFURLCreateBookmarkDataFromAliasRecord() was intended as a way to convert alias 
records stored a program's own data files to a bookmark data with no I/O.
